  • Paul Levinson interviews Dan Abella about his upcoming Psychedelic Festival

    29/09/2023 Duração: 37min

    Welcome to Light On Light Through, Episode 355, in which I interview Dan Abella about the upcoming Psychedelic Film and Music Festival he is organizing.  The Festival will take place October 20-22, 2023 in New York City, and there will both live and remote events and access.   • Paul Levinson interviews Spencer Hannabuss

    15/05/2023 Duração: 01h10s

    Welcome to Light On Light Through, Episode 352, in which I interview Spencer Hannabuss, who sang "If I Traveled to the Past" at the end of the It's Real Life radio play adapted from my alternate history story about The Beatles, streaming on Killerwatt Radio.  We also discuss our views of The Beatles and their preeminent role in popular culture.  The interview concludes with a mini-concert of three songs by Spencer Hannabuss.
